QuartusII命令行脚本参考手册

5星 · 超过95%的资源 需积分: 9 8 下载量 125 浏览量 更新于2024-07-28 收藏 3.47MB PDF 举报
"QuartusII脚本参考手册是学习QuartusII命令行操作和Tool Command Language (Tcl)脚本的重要参考资料。手册由Altera公司出版,详细介绍了QuartusII的命令行功能和Tcl脚本的使用。" QuartusII是一款由Altera公司开发的综合、分析、优化和编程FPGA(Field-Programmable Gate Array)的设计工具。它提供了图形用户界面(GUI)以及命令行接口,以满足不同层次的用户需求。对于自动化流程或需要批量处理的工作,命令行和Tcl脚本的使用显得尤为重要。 该"QuartusII Scripting Reference Manual"涵盖了以下几个关键知识点: 1. **命令行操作**:手册详细列出了QuartusII的各种命令行工具,包括项目管理、综合、布局布线、仿真、编程等各个阶段的命令。这些命令允许用户在命令行环境下执行设计流程,提高工作效率。 2. **Tcl语言基础**:Tcl是一种简单易学的脚本语言,被广泛用于自动化任务。手册会介绍Tcl的基础语法,如变量、控制结构、函数调用等,并演示如何在QuartusII环境中应用Tcl脚本来定制设计流程。 3. **脚本编写与调试**:手册会教导用户如何编写和调试QuartusII的Tcl脚本,包括错误处理、脚本组织结构、以及如何调用QuartusII的API进行高级操作。 4. **设计流程自动化**:通过Tcl脚本,用户可以实现设计流程的自动化,例如批量处理多个设计、自动优化参数、自定义报告生成等,极大地提高了设计效率。 5. **知识产权管理**:对于包含多个模块或IP核的设计,手册还会介绍如何在脚本中管理这些知识产权(IP),包括导入、配置和验证IP。 6. **版本控制集成**:QuartusII支持与版本控制系统如Git的集成,手册会指导用户如何在脚本中进行版本控制操作,确保设计文件的版本管理和协同工作。 7. **错误处理和调试技巧**:手册还将提供关于如何处理和调试脚本错误的指导,帮助用户解决在实际使用中可能遇到的问题。 8. **标准保修和责任声明**:手册最后会包含Altera公司的标准保修条款和免责声明,提醒用户尽管产品受到多项专利保护,但使用任何信息、产品或服务时,Altera不承担任何因应用或使用而产生的责任或损失,除非有书面协议明确约定。 通过深入学习这本"QuartusII Scripting Reference Manual",无论是初级还是高级的FPGA开发者,都能提升其在QuartusII环境下的编程和自动化能力,进一步优化设计流程。